Therapeutic strategies targeting dormancy-reactivation of cancer cells. A Proliferating cancer cells can be eliminated using traditional anti-proliferative chemotherapeutic drugs through a process of inducing reactivation of dormant cancer cells. B Dormant cancer cells after primary treatment for cancer can be maintained in dormant state for a long time. C After primary treatment for cancer, residual cancer cells can be completely eradicated. The size of the yellow circles refers the expected tumor burden at each step
